Facilities Overview

The school campus in Nyarutarama includes classrooms, outdoor learning spaces, sports areas, and a medical facility with a professional nurse on staff.

Sports Facilities

Sports and physical activity areas on campus. Aerobics programme available for students.

Academic Facilities

Classrooms designed for varied learning approaches including whole-class, small group and individual instruction. Indoor and outdoor learning environments.

Extra-Curricular Activities

Aerobics, after-school activities, class trips, international trips, Career Day, Pyjama Day, morning devotion, and various arts and sports programmes.

Bright Angels International School (BAIS) is a bilingual English and French international school in the Nyarutarama neighbourhood of Kigali, Rwanda. Founded in 2013 by Mrs. Francine N., the school serves over 700 students of 18+ nationalities from daycare through lower secondary. BAIS follows the Cambridge Primary and Lower Secondary curriculum alongside the French learning curriculum, and prepares students for Cambridge and DELF examinations. The school emphasises inclusive, holistic education underpinned by Christian values.
